Old Fort Jackson is a National Historic Landmark located on the eastern end of the city, right on the Savannah River. This early 19th-century fort is the oldest standing brick fortification in Georgia. Historical Interpreters in historical military impressions provide multi-era military history programming with daily historical weapons demonstrations and activities appropriate for all ages.
